Summary

Upgrade release-please-action from v4.4.0 to v5.0.0 to resolve the Node.js 20 deprecation warning. The only meaningful change in v5 is the runtime bump from node20 to node24; all action inputs/outputs remain identical.

Overview
Upgrades the googleapis/release-please-action used by the release-please GitHub Actions workflow from v4 to v5.0.0 (updated pinned commit).

No other workflow logic, permissions, or publish steps are changed.
